- ZOIP package in R to analyse inflated proportional data with zeros and/or ones

Data obtained from variables measured as percentages, rates and proportions are called proportional data and these variables are usually within the (0,1) interval. Although, different distributions have been developed to characterize these variables, it is possible that some variables take the extreme values at zero and one. Some researchers as Ospina & Ferrari (2012) and Rigby & Stasinopoulos (2005) proposed the inflated Beta distribution with zeros and/or ones, differentiated only by their parameterization. Other authors such as Galvis & Lachos (2014) have worked with inflated proportional data, considering other distributions such as simplex distributions. Nevertheless, it has not been found any distribution which combines the main characteristic of several distributions for solving these issue. Thus, this paper presents the ZOIP package (Zeros Ones Inflated Proportional), developed on the computation system R, this package combines both Beta and simplex distribution and estimates its parameters given the parameters for the original distributions. The parameters estimation process, is performed by maximum likelihood method. Finally, simulations studies have been performed which show the accuracy of the parameters convergence and the adjustment of a ZOIP distribution on real data
